University of the Sciences in Philadelphia Names New Director of Writing Center

University of the Sciences in Philadelphia (USP) recently named Dr. Justin Everett as the new director of USP’s Writing Center. Dr. Everett brings to the position considerable experience in teaching rhetoric to native and non-native speakers both in the classroom and in one-on-one tutorials. He has instructed courses at the University of Oklahoma, the University of Central Oklahoma, and Tulsa Community College, where he was also the coordinator of the writing center. He received a B.A. in English at Oklahoma State University and an M.A. in English and Ph.D. in English education at the University of Oklahoma.

The Writing Center provides students, faculty and staff with assistance in all writing tasks. Students may get help with writing assignments for any class. The Writing Center also provides English as a Second Language (ESL) assistance to non-native English speaking students in writing, grammar, pronunciation and speaking. Computers are available for use with writing projects, and help with resumes and applications is also available. Tutoring sessions are scheduled by appointment, but drop-ins are also welcome. The Center is staffed by faculty and peer tutors.

University of the Sciences in Philadelphia is a private, coeducational institution founded in 1821 as Philadelphia College of Pharmacy, the first college of pharmacy in North America. USP specializes in educating students for rewarding careers through its professional and pre-professional degrees in health sciences, pharmaceutical sciences, and arts and sciences.
